I have the same issue, as does another rider I spoke to with the same pedals. I think because of the shape of the pedal and where the weight on it sits, it tends to flip upside down (drives me nuts too!). I've gotten in the habit of sticking the toe of my shoe into the depression on the underside and using that to get a quick pedal in, then sort of scooping my foot under the pedal to flip it around and (if all goes well) clip it in quickly.
Of course, this doesn't always work as well as planned, but if thinks start getting dodgy I just do the toe pedal thing a couple more times quickly so I can try the process again.
